What is a manager analyst?

Manager Analysts, often known as management analysts or management consultants, are professionals who evaluate an organization's operations and recommend improvements to boost efficiency, productivity, and profitability. They gather and analyze data, interview personnel, and develop solutions to organizational problems. Manager Analysts typically work with management teams to implement new procedures or changes, and may specialize in a particular industry or business function. Their work helps organizations optimize processes and adapt to changing business environments.

What opportunities for career advancement are typically available to manager analysts within an organization?

Manager Analysts often have clear pathways for career advancement, especially as they gain experience leading projects and teams. Many organizations offer progression into higher management roles, such as Senior Manager, Director of Analysis, or even Vice President of Operations, depending on performance and organizational structure. Advancement often involves taking on more strategic responsibilities, managing larger teams, and influencing broader business decisions. Professional development, mentorship, and cross-functional projects also support growth, allowing Manager Analysts to expand their expertise and impact within the company.

What is the difference between Manager Analyst vs Business Analyst?

AspectManager AnalystBusiness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ree; often advanced degrees or certifications like PMP or Six SigmaBachelor's degree; certifications like CBAP or PMI-PBA are common
Work EnvironmentTypically in corporate or consulting settings, overseeing teams and projectsUsually in IT, finance, or business departments analyzing processes and requirements
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across industries for strategic and operational rolesCommon in technology, finance, and healthcare sectors for project analysis

The Manager Analyst role combines analytical skills with managerial responsibilities, often overseeing projects and teams. In contrast, a Business Analyst focuses on analyzing business needs and processes to recommend solutions. While both roles require strong analytical skills and relevant certifications, the Manager Analyst typically has additional leadership duties and strategic oversight.

Job DescriptionSenior IT Financial Performance Analyst
Build the Future with Us

Are you passionate about financial and operational analysis and looking to contribute to the performance of a strategic Information Technology sector? At iA Financial Group, you will have the opportunity to leverage your analytical expertise to support decision-making and continuous improvement.


As a Senior IT Financial Performance Analyst, you will play a key role in monitoring the financial and operational performance of IT teams. You will contribute to the achievement of business objectives by acting as a trusted business partner to managers and by delivering analyses, forecasts, and recommendations that support informed decision-making.


What You Will Accomplish with Us

As a Senior IT Financial Performance Analyst, you will be at the heart of our mission. Your main responsibilities will include:

  • Providing the sector Delivery Lead with a consolidated view of all financial indicators (expense monitoring, variances, etc.) and operational indicators (e.g., workforce tracking, capacity management, timesheet quality, actual consultant rates), as well as relevant performance trends.
  • Acting as a liaison with delivery team managers (directors, assistant directors, etc.) and supporting them by providing information, services, and guidance to help maximize financial and organizational performance.
  • Conducting various analyses, including sector expenses, project credit rates, overhead allocation, and other ad hoc management analyses; making recommendations, communicating impacts, and developing action plans when required.
  • Producing management reports, analyzing variances, ensuring discrepancies are addressed, and recommending actions to the Senior Director and the sector management committee.
  • Preparing forecasts, documenting and communicating them, and advising managers when variances occur.
  • Developing and presenting the annual IT budget for the sector.
  • Supporting other Performance Analysts in the resolution of complex issues and projects.
  • Working closely with Portfolio Management teams, particularly in the development of Lean Business Cases (LBCs) and Strategic Business Cases (SBCs).
  • Improving processes and procedures to increase efficiency through automation.
  • Ensuring the application and deployment of policies and guidelines.

What Could Help You Succeed in This Role

We are looking for someone who:

  • Holds a bachelor's degree in Accounting, Business Administration, or another related field.
  • Has a minimum of 10 years of experience in a similar role.
  • Is recognized for strong analytical skills and the ability to transform complex data into clear and meaningful insights.
  • Demonstrates excellent communication skills and the ability to present analyses to a variety of stakeholders.
  • Shows a high level of rigor, attention to detail, and a results- and solutions-oriented mindset.
  • Demonstrates positive leadership, collaboration, and influence with business partners.
  • Has a strong interest in the field of Information Technology.
  • Is autonomous, proactive, creative, and able to manage competing pri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Has strong proficiency with the Microsoft Office Suite, particularly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
  • Holds a CPA designation (an asset).
  • Has knowledge of Power BI, ERP systems (e.g., Oracle), and/or Planning Cloud (an asset).
  • Has an intermediate level of English proficiency, as the incumbent will be required to deliver presentations, participate in discussions, and draft emails with internal partners on a weekly basis.
